The New York Rangers can still make a shocking trade before the season

The New York Rangers have a chance to pull off one of the most shocking trades of the off-season while also taking advantage of the Dylan Larkin trade market at the same time. If the Rangers could get their captain, J.T. Miller, to agree to it, they could look to trade him to the Minnesota Wild, who are in desperate need of a top-line center, and change the entire landscape of their offense.

Miller to the Wild would be the deal of the summer

Obviously, this scenario is very unlikely to happen. However, it is an interesting theory that the Rangers could capitalize on. With teams like the Wild looking all over for a top-line center, and the Detroit Red Wings and Larkin not finding middle ground on a new home. The Rangers could approach Miller and suggest the idea. If he agrees, he joins a Stanley Cup contender, which has a number of his USA gold medal teammates on it. He could be the last addition to put their organization over the edge and get them to the Stanley Cup Finals.

That is not to say that Miller is unhappy in New York. He clearly loves being a Ranger and the captain. He has been vocal about that. This idea is purely speculative. The trade would make a lot of sense, though. The Rangers have made the direction of their organization quite clear; they are retooling. They want to build around their younger players and restructure their roster. So, because of that, it could make sense to approach Miller with the trade and see if he would welcome a chance to win a Cup with the Wild.

The Wild have been linked to Larkin since the day that the news broke that he requested a trade out of Detroit. In theory, it makes sense; their biggest need is a top-line center. Outside of that hole within their roster, it’s stacked. However, the Wild aren’t exclusively looking to trade with the Wings for Larkin. They’d likely be open to any top-line center that makes their team better and wouldn’t cost them their entire future.

So naturally, Miller’s fit is perfect. He could step into the Wild’s organization, be the top-line center, score a ton of points, and, if he were lucky, win a Cup or two. Not to mention the return that the Rangers would likely get for Miller. It would likely include Danila Yurov, Charlie Stramel, and other future assets as well as draft picks. It could be a five-to-six-piece package for a 33-year-old Miller, who simply doesn’t fit with the Rangers’ timeline.

This is the type of trade that would leave the fanbase shocked, and because of that, it could very well not happen. However, if it does, it is a true telling that the Rangers are shifting from a retool to a rebuild.
